Due to popular demand, we return to Highgate Cemetery for a guided tour of the private West Cemetery and its atmospheric Lebanon Circle Vaults, Egyptian Avenue and recently opened Terrace Catacombs.
Opened in 1839 as one of the "Magnificent Seven" cemeteries, built to relieve the overcrowding of small inner-London graveyards, Highgate has some of the finest funerary architecture in the country and has been designated by English Heritage as a Grade I-listed park. On our private tour, Friends learn about the symbolism of the monuments’ architecture, as well as the history behind some of the cemetery’s most interesting residents.
Our tour of the gated West Cemetery includes the Lebanon Circle Vaults, which surround a massive ancient cedar tree that long predates the cemetery itself. We also stop in Egyptian Avenue to learn more about the great interest in Egyptian architecture and memorialisation of the dead at the time the cemetery was created.
